在当今高度依赖互联网的环境中,用户常面临访问速度慢、网站打不开或延迟高的问题,很多人会尝试两种常见方法来“提速”:一是修改本地Hosts文件以绕过DNS解析延迟;二是使用虚拟私人网络(VPN)来加密流量并切换路由路径,到底哪种方式更快?作为网络工程师,我将从原理、适用场景和实际测试结果三个方面深入剖析,帮你做出科学决策。
理解两者的工作机制至关重要。
Hosts文件是操作系统中一个静态的域名映射表,它允许你手动指定某个域名对应的具体IP地址,跳过传统的DNS查询过程,如果你发现访问百度时总是卡顿,而你知道其IP地址稳定,就可以在Hosts文件中添加一行:76.15.12 www.baidu.com,这样系统直接用这个IP访问,避免了DNS解析延迟(通常几十到几百毫秒),这种方法特别适合固定IP服务(如国内CDN节点),但缺点也很明显:如果目标服务器IP变动,就会失效;且无法解决网络拥塞或链路质量差的问题。
相比之下,VPN是一种通过加密隧道将流量转发到远程服务器的技术,它不仅能隐藏真实IP地址,还能改变数据传输路径——比如从国内走国际链路变为走美国或新加坡的服务器,这在访问海外网站(如Google、GitHub)时效果显著,因为能避开国内网络瓶颈,但VPN本身也有代价:加密解密带来CPU开销,隧道传输增加额外延迟(一般30–150ms不等),而且若服务器负载高或地理位置远,反而可能更慢。
哪个更快?答案取决于你的具体需求:
-
如果你是国内用户访问国内网站(如淘宝、腾讯视频),且遇到DNS解析慢,修改Hosts文件几乎总是更快,实测显示,在某些情况下,Hosts可减少200–500ms的访问延迟。
-
如果你需要访问境外资源(如GitHub、YouTube),或者你在使用某些被限速的服务(如流媒体平台),此时选择高质量的商业VPN(如ExpressVPN、NordVPN)往往更有效,即使有轻微延迟,整体体验也优于未加速的直连。
值得注意的是,有些用户混淆了“快”和“稳定”,Hosts可以提速,但不能改善带宽或丢包率;而好的VPN虽然增加一点延迟,却能提供更稳定的连接质量,劣质免费VPN不仅可能变慢,还存在隐私泄露风险,务必谨慎选择。
最后建议:不要二选一,而是组合使用,对常用国内站点配置Hosts文件提升响应速度,同时为跨境业务启用可靠VPN,日常维护中,定期检查Hosts是否过期,并监控网络质量(可用ping、traceroute工具辅助判断)。
Hosts适合解决“小而快”的问题,VPN擅长处理“大而远”的挑战,作为网络工程师,我推荐你根据实际应用场景灵活搭配,才能真正实现高效、安全、稳定的上网体验。

VPN加速器|半仙VPN加速器-免费VPN梯子首选半仙VPN

